The full breakdown
What it's made of and why it matters
Rove Concepts lists this sectional as 'brushed fabric' upholstery but does not publicly specify fiber content (polyester, cotton blend, synthetic) or backing materials. Brushed finishes typically indicate either a cotton-rich or polyester base; polyester carries antimony catalysts and is often treated with stain repellents (likely PFAS-based given the 75/100 PFAS score). Without material specifications, you cannot verify if adhesives, flame-retardant chemicals, or formaldehyde-based resins are present in the cushion cores or frame.
The brand's record and disclosure
Rove Concepts maintains a minimal public stance on chemical content and does not advertise third-party certifications (Oeko-Tex, GOTS, or GREENGUARD) for this model. The brand's silent posture on PFAS and lack of transparency on material sourcing or testing is typical of mid-market furniture makers but represents a red flag for buyers prioritizing chemical disclosure. No major recalls or established controversies about this specific product line are documented.

If you buy it
Contact Rove Concepts directly to request a material specification sheet (fiber %, backing type, adhesive, flame-retardant chemistry, stain-treatment compounds). Ventilate the room for 48-72 hours after delivery to allow off-gassing of any adhesives or treatments. Clean spills promptly with plain water or mild soap; avoid aggressive solvents or heat application that could degrade coatings or trigger chemical release. Inspect seams and backing annually for degradation; if you develop respiratory irritation or skin reactions, this may indicate off-gassing or residual chemical sensitivity and warrants moving or professional cleaning.
Beyond PFAS: other things we checked
Established hazard classes for this product type, assessed from public information. These never change the PFAS grade; a Likely flag caps the Verdict at “Buy with care.”
Formaldehyde-based resins in foam cores and adhesives
Upholstered sectional cushion cores typically use polyurethane foam bonded with formaldehyde-releasing glues; Rove Concepts does not disclose whether low-emitting binders are used. Off-gassing is usually highest in the first weeks but can persist for months in poorly ventilated spaces.
Antimony catalyst residue in polyester fabric (if present)
If the brushed fabric is polyester-dominant, antimony oxide catalysts remain as trace residues. Antimony is a suspected toxicant and immunotoxin; exposure risk is low during normal use but increases with wear (abrasion releasing microparticles) or if fabric degrades.
Flame-retardant chemicals (non-PFAS halogenated or phosphorus-based)
US residential furniture must meet flammability standards (CA TB 117 or similar); Rove Concepts likely applies halogenated (chlorinated/brominated) or organophosphate flame retardants to the fabric or foam. These are not PFAS but are endocrine disruptors and bioaccumulative and are unspecified in marketing.
Volatile organic compounds (VOCs) from adhesives and finish coatings
Brushed-fabric finishing processes and seam-sealing adhesives release VOCs (toluene, xylene, formaldehyde) especially during the first 30 days. Adequate ventilation is essential; poor air exchange will concentrate off-gassing and increase inhalation exposure.
Microplastic shedding from synthetic fabric wear
Brushed synthetics degrade more readily than tight weaves; normal use (friction, body contact) releases microfibers into the air and onto skin. Risk is proportional to polyester content and inversely proportional to fabric durability, neither of which is disclosed.
